A porch enclosure is a structure that is built to enclose part or all of a porch. The enclosure can be made from a variety of materials such as wood, aluminum, glass, and screening. Porch enclosures can be used to create a more comfortable outdoor living space. They can be designed to include windows and doors, allowing natural light and ventilation to enter the area. Many enclosures can also be customized with additional features such as skylights, shutters, and decorative accents. Porch enclosures can be used to extend the overall living space of a home and create a private outdoor oasis. They are also a great way to increase the value of a home, as they can provide additional square footage and a luxurious aesthetic.

Cost of Building a Porch Enclosure

The cost of building a porch enclosure can vary based on the type of materials used, the size of the project, and the complexity of the design. The cost of labour will also factor into the overall cost, as will the time needed to complete the project. For example, a screened-in porch enclosure with a simple design may cost less than one with a more intricate design. In addition, the cost of materials such as wood, aluminum, glass, and screening will also affect the total cost of the project. It is important to get an accurate estimate of the cost of building a porch enclosure before beginning the project.

In Ottawa, obtaining a building permit is a crucial step when planning a new addition to your home. A building permit ensures that the proposed construction meets the necessary building codes and safety standards, as well as adheres to local zoning bylaws.
